(Lesson 4633)(10-10-24) Acts 9:10-16 

   “And there was a certain disciple at Damascus, named Ananias; and to him said the Lord in a vision, Ananias. And he said, Behold, I am here, Lord. And the Lord said unto him, Arise, and go into the street which is called Straight, and enquire in the house of Judas for one called Saul, of Tarsus: for, behold, he prayeth, And hath seen in a vision a man named Ananias coming in, and putting his hand on him, that he might receive his sight. Then Ananias answered, Lord, I have heard by many of this man, how much evil he hath done to thy saints at Jerusalem: And here he hath authority from the chief priests to bind all that call on thy name. But the Lord said unto him, Go thy way: for he is a chosen vessel unto me, to bear my name before the Gentiles, and kings, and the children of Israel: For I will shew him how great things he must suffer for my name's sake.” 

 

   Today’s quote recounts the Lord speaking to a disciple named Ananias in a vision, instructing him to go to Saul. Ananias was hesitant due to Saul’s reputation for persecuting Christians, but the Lord reassured him, saying Saul was a chosen vessel to bear His name before Gentiles, kings, and the children of Israel, and would suffer for His sake. ~
